Comprehensive Manufacturer Directory

  1. Atlas Copco: Swedish multinational offering complete range from portable to large stationary compressors with industry-leading energy efficiency.
  2. Ingersoll Rand: American industrial giant providing innovative compressed air solutions for over 100 years with global service network.
  3. Kaeser Compressors: German precision engineering company specializing in rotary screw compressors with Sigma profile technology.
  4. Sullair: American manufacturer known for durable rotary screw air compressors with patented airend design.
  5. Gardner Denver: Global provider of industrial compressors, blowers, pumps, and vacuum technologies.
  6. BOGE Kompressoren: German manufacturer offering oil-free and lubricated compressors with advanced control systems.
  7. Chicago Pneumatic: Industrial tools and compressor manufacturer with focus on construction and manufacturing sectors.
  8. Quincy Compressor: American company specializing in reciprocating and rotary screw compressors since 1920.
  9. ELGi Equipments: Indian multinational offering complete compressed air solutions with global presence.
  10. Hitachi Industrial Equipment: Japanese technology leader in screw and scroll compressors with advanced IoT capabilities.

Industrial Compressor Types

Rotary Screw Compressors

Most common industrial type using two intermeshing rotors to compress air. Known for continuous duty, high efficiency, and reliability in demanding applications.

Reciprocating Compressors

Piston-type compressors ideal for intermittent duty and high-pressure applications. Available in single or multi-stage configurations for pressures up to 5000 PSI.

Centrifugal Compressors

Dynamic compressors using high-speed impellers for large volume applications (5,000+ CFM). Oil-free operation with multi-stage designs for high efficiency.

Scroll Compressors

Quiet, oil-free operation using two interleaving scrolls. Ideal for clean air applications with lower capacity requirements and minimal maintenance.

Oil-Free Compressors

Critical for food, pharmaceutical, and electronics industries where air purity is essential. Use special coatings and designs to eliminate oil contamination.

Portable Compressors

Mobile units for construction, mining, and remote applications. Diesel or electric powered with towable designs for job site flexibility.

Compressor Selection Guide

Application Recommended Type Key Considerations
Continuous Manufacturing Rotary Screw Compressor Variable speed drive, energy recovery, adequate capacity margin
Intermittent Workshop Use Reciprocating Compressor Duty cycle, tank size, multiple compressor staging
Large Volume Processing Centrifugal Compressor Base load requirements, multi-stage efficiency, turndown capability
Clean Room Applications Oil-Free Scroll/Screw ISO 8573 Class, filtration requirements, maintenance protocols
Construction Sites Portable Diesel Compressor Mobility, fuel efficiency, environmental regulations, noise limits
High Pressure Testing Multi-Stage Reciprocating Pressure requirements, safety systems, cooling requirements

Selection Criteria Checklist

  • Air Demand: Calculate CFM requirements including peak demands and future expansion
  • Pressure Requirements: Determine minimum working pressure plus distribution losses
  • Air Quality: Assess ISO 8573 class requirements for your application
  • Energy Efficiency: Consider variable speed drives and energy recovery systems
  • Space Constraints: Evaluate available space for compressor and ancillary equipment
  • Maintenance Access: Ensure adequate space for routine maintenance and service
  • Noise Considerations: Check local regulations and workplace noise limits
  • Total Cost of Ownership: Evaluate purchase price, energy costs, and maintenance expenses
